#554139 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#554139 is composed of 33.3% red, 25.5%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.5% magenta, 32.9%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 17.1 degrees, a saturation of 19.7% and a lightness of 27.8%. #554139 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a8272 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#554139 color description : Very dark grayish orange.
#554139 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#554139 has RGB values of R:85, G:65,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.33,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5587257.
